Chief Accountant – Taxation – Alfardan Corporation

We are seeking a Chief Accountant – Taxation to take full ownership of tax accounting, regional tax compliance, and strategic tax integration across the group. In this role, you will be responsible for overseeing tax calendar compliance without failure, managing local and international tax requirements, analyzing evolving tax regulations, and ensuring precise tax accounting within Autoline across all business units.  

Key Responsibilities
Tax Compliance & Regional Filings

  • Ensure accuracy, timely review, and filing of Withholding Tax (WHT) returns, Contract reporting, Tax returns, and WHT/Corporate Tax payments to General Tax Authorities in Qatar and Oman.  
  • Oversee transfer pricing regulations to ensure full compliance for all inter-company transactions within the Group and sister companies.  
  • Analyze and interpret tax regulations, policies, and developments applicable to the company, evaluating the overall impact on the organization.  
  • Ensure tax credits, wherever applicable, are properly accounted for and utilized in accordance with local law.  
  • Prepare and maintain a robust tax calendar to ensure 100% compliance without failure.  

VAT Implementation & Accounting Integration

  • Lead the impact analysis and process design for VAT laws in Qatar, including system/software implementation and legal structure considerations.  
  • Ensure accuracy and timely reporting of VAT returns and related information to the Tax Authority.  
  • Ensure all tax and VAT accruals are accurately accounted for in Autoline (accounting software).  
  • Coordinate with Budget, MIS, and Procurement teams to ensure proper communication and accurate incorporation of tax/VAT amounts on Purchase Orders (POs).  
  • Ensure tax expenses are fully evaluated and integrated into periodical budgets.  

Stakeholder Advisory & Authority Representation

  • Respond directly to Tax Authorities regarding queries and supporting documentation required during tax assessments.  
  • Serve as an internal advisor, providing timely guidance and clear communication on tax matters to respective Business Units (BUs) and BU Chief Accountants.  
  • Coordinate with corporate tax consultants for expert interpretation, guidance, and legal applicability of tax laws.  
  • Partner with the Government Relations Department to ensure timely renewal and display of tax certificates and Tax Identification Numbers (TIN) across all locations.  
  • Systematically archive all key tax documentation (Payment challans, Tax Returns, WHT certificates, Annual Returns, and VAT filings).  

Minimum Requirements & Qualifications

  • Education: Bachelor’s Degree in Accounting, Commerce, or a related field (Master’s in Accounting is a plus).  
  • Experience: 4-6 years of relevant experience in tax accounting, tax compliance, and financial management.
